DO THE DERIVATIVES MARKETS MAKE COAL PRICES MORE VOLATILE? 59.21% SAY YES, POLL
COALspot.com: The substantial increase or decrease in coal prices within a short period of time has been supported by a number of fundamental drivers.
In addition to fundamental supply and demand factors, the activity of speculators in financial markets also playing a significant role in contributing to the increase or decrease in the level and volatility of coal prices in recent months.
Do the derivatives markets make coal prices more volatile?
COALspot.com on-line response survey was conducted during 1st week of December 2016 and according to the survey, 59.21% of around 152 respondents believed that derivatives markets can affect the short-run price dynamics for coal.
 |
The on-line opinion poll conducted by COALspot.com over 5 to 11 December 2016 involved around 152 coal market participants, with respondents, including (likely) producers, end-users, traders and others.
When those surveyed were asked, "do the derivatives markets make coal prices more volatile", 59.21 percent of participants choose derivatives markets could affect the short-run price dynamics for coal, versus 11.18 percent who choose "No" and saying derivatives markets cannot influence the short-run price dynamics for coal.
Among the 59.21% respondents who choose derivatives markets could affect the short-run price dynamics for coal a 36.18 percent of respondents picked the answer “Yes, drastically affecting” while another 23.03 percent says "Yes, but slightly affecting".
A 29.61% respondent says "May be" and 11.18% say "NO".
Coal Miners
Some 58.97 percents of around 39 likely coal miners say “Yes" and another 30.77 percent of coal miners say "May be" derivatives markets is influencing coal price movements.
 |
Some 10.26 percent of likely coal miners picked the answer “NO“. Around 39 likely coal miners participated in this on-line opinion poll.
Coal end-users
Among the likely coal end users, some 68.18 per cent respondents' joint hand with "Yes" group and only 9.09 percent likely end-users say "NO". 22.73% of participants representing likely coal end-users say "May be". Around 22 likely coal end-users participated in this on-line opinion poll.
Coal Traders
Among the likely coal traders, some 57.15 percent, says "Yes" derivatives markets are influencing coal price movements, while another 33.93 percent of likely coal traders say "May be". 8.93% of another set of coal traders believed that derivatives markets cannot decide the direction of coal prices.
Around 56 likely coal traders participated in this on-line opinion poll last week.
The COALspot opinion poll was conducted online between, 5 Dec 00:01 GMT to 11 Dec 2016 23:59 GMT. The latest poll responded by total 152 visitors, 39 who identified themselves as coal miners, 22 respondents identified themselves as end-users and 56 participants who identified themselves as coal traders.
Around 35 participants identified themselves as “Others”. Some 31.43 percents of around 35 others say “Yes, slightly" and another 25.71 percent say " Yes, drastically". A 25.71 percent of others say "May be" and 17.14 percent of others says No, derivatives markets cannot decide the direction of coal prices.
